What I Look for Before Buying

Before I buy any 20V staple gun, I focus on a few important factors:

  • Power and performance: I want the stapler to drive staples consistently without jamming.
  • Battery compatibility: Since I already use DeWalt 20V batteries, I prefer a model that fits my existing setup.
  • Staple size support: I make sure it handles the staple lengths I need for my projects.
  • Weight and comfort: I prefer a tool that feels balanced in my hand during long use.
  • Safety features: I look for trigger locks and contact-trip mechanisms for safer operation.

Key Features I Pay Attention To

When I compare models, I usually check these features closely:

  • Brushless motor: I like this because it often gives better runtime and durability.
  • Depth adjustment: This helps me control how deep the staple goes into the material.
  • Jam clearing: I value easy access if a staple gets stuck.
  • Magazine capacity: A larger magazine means fewer reloads for me.
  • LED light: This is helpful when I work in low-light areas.

Battery and Runtime Considerations

Since it runs on a 20V battery, I make sure I have a battery with enough capacity for my workload. For heavier jobs, I usually choose a higher amp-hour battery so I can work longer without stopping to recharge. That makes a big difference in my productivity.
